Transaction 3ec497d76231bbda3a4be206605b0be4bc8beb035be241f61a22e8bc661c5879
1 Input
1 Output
-
3ec497d76231bbda3a4be206605b0be4bc8beb035be241f61a22e8bc661c5879:0
- value
- 5261836
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ded668fe0da35a992bca38e5c3b7667b24556523 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MKFs4fKf9CNiSsusrzbrpRf8PgnnpzsL9